TITLE 13--CENSUS
CHAPTER 3--COLLECTION AND PUBLICATION OF STATISTICS
SUBCHAPTER I--COTTON
Sec. 41. Collection and publication
The Secretary shall collect and publish statistics concerning the--
(1) amount of cotton ginned;
(2) quantity of raw cotton consumed in manufacturing
establishments of every character;
(3) quantity of baled cotton on hand;
(4) number of active consuming cotton spindles;
(5) number of active spindle hours; and
(6) quantity of cotton imported and exported, with the country
of origin and destination.
(Aug. 31, 1954, ch. 1158, 68 Stat. 1016.)
Historical and Revision Notes
Based on title 13, U.S.C., 1952 ed., Sec. 71 (Apr. 2, 1924, ch. 80,
Sec. 1, 43 Stat. 31; June 18, 1929, ch. 28, Sec. 21, 46 Stat. 26).
``Secretary'' was substituted for ``Director of the Census'' to
conform with 1950 Reorganization Plan No. 5, Secs. 1, 2, effective May
24, 1950, 15 F.R. 3174, 64 Stat. 1263. See Revision Note to section 4 of
this title.
Changes were made in phraseology and arrangement.
